body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	text-align: justify;
}

.basefrm { font-family:tahoma; font-size:10px; color:#F5C6B4; background-color:#D83F02; border:1px solid #A63002 }
.button { font-size: 12px; vertical-align: middle; xcolor:#F5C6B4; background-color:#D83F02; padding: 5px; border: 1px dotted #CC0000 }

img			{ border: 0px none; }
img#logo		{ width: 138px; height: 124px; border:0px none;}
img.btn			{ padding: 5px; border: 1px dotted #CC0000 }
img.more		{ border: 0px; height: 20px; width: 20px; }
a:hover 	img.btn	{ border: dotted 1px #FFFF00; }

.ns a:link 	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.ns a:visited 	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.ns a:active	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.ns a:hover	{ color: #FFFFFF; text-decoration: none; border: 0px none; }

.mnu		{ color: #FFFFFF; font-family: Arial, Helvetica; font-size: 12px; font-weight: bold; text-transform: uppercase }
.mnu img	{ width: 7px; height: 7px; margin-right: 5px }
.mnu a:link 	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.mnu a:visited	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.mnu a:active	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.mnu a:hover	{ color: #FFFF00; text-decoration: none; border: 0px none; }

.nu a:link	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.nu a:visited	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.nu a:active	{ color: #FFFFFF; text-decoration: none; border: 0px none; }
.nu a:hover	{ color: #FFFF00; text-decoration: none; border: 0px none; }

a:link      { color: #FFFFFF;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}
a:visited   { color: #FFFFFF;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}
a:active    { color: #FFFFFF;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}
a:hover     { color: #FFFF00;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}

.table-std3 a:link		{ color: #000000; font-style: italic; text-decoration: underline; }
.table-std3 a:link		{ color: #000000; font-style: normal; text-decoration: underline; }
.table-std3 a:visited	{ color: #000000; text-decoration: underline; }
.table-std3 a:active	{ color: #000000; text-decoration: underline; }
.table-std3 a:hover		{ color: #FFFFFF; text-decoration: underline; }

.table-std3 .txt-main a:link      { color: #000000;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}
.table-std3 .txt-main a:visited   { color: #000000;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}
.table-std3 .txt-main a:active    { color: #000000;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}
.table-std3 .txt-main a:hover     { color: #FFFF00; text-decoration: none; border-bottom: 1px dotted; white-space: nowrap}


.table-std	{ border: 0px none; cell-padding: 0; border-collapse: collapse; border-spacing: 0; width: 100%; height: 100%}
.table-std2, .bl-td	{ border-spacing: 0px; border-collapse: collapse; empty-cells: hide; border: 0px}
td.main	{ text-align: justify; padding: 10px; }

td.hdr	{ font-weight: bold; color: #FFFFFF;}
td.hdr	a:link { font-style: normal; color: #FFFFFF; border-bottom: 0px none }

.table-std3	{ padding: 0px; border: 0px;} 
.table-std3 td.hdr	{ 
font-weight: bold; 
color: #FFFFFF;
filter: alpha (opacity=20);
/* Fallback for web browsers that doesn't support RGBa */
background: rgb(0, 0, 0) transparent;
/* RGBa with 0.6 opacity */
background: rgba(0, 0, 0, 0.2);
/* For IE 5.5 - 7*/
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#87878787, endColorstr=#87878787);
/* For IE 8*/
-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r=#87878787, endColorstr=#87878787)";

}

.table-std3 td {
font-size: 10pt;
color: #000000;
filter: alpha (opacity=50);
/* Fallback for web browsers that doesn't support RGBa */
background: rgb(255, 255, 255) transparent;
/* RGBa with 0.6 opacity */
background: rgba(255, 255, 255, 0.5);
/* For IE 5.5 - 7*/
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#CCCCCCCC, endColorstr=#CCCCCCCC);
/* For IE 8*/
-ms-filter: "progid:DXImageTransform.Microsoft.gradient(startColorstr=#CCCCCCCC, endColorstr=#CCCCCCCC)";
}


.header-main	{ font-weight: bold; text-transform: uppercase; text-decoration: underline; font-style: oblique; font-family: Arial, Helvetica; font-size: 16px; color: #254878}
.header-sub		{ font-weight: bold; text-transform: uppercase; text-decoration: none; font-family: Tahoma, Arial, Helvetica; font-size: 14px; color: #FFFFFF}
.header-sub2	{ font-weight: bold; font-family: Verdana, Helvetica; font-size: 11px;}


hr				{ border: 0px none; width: 100%; height: 1px; background-color: #254878;}
hr.hr2			{ border: 0px none; width: 100%; height: 1px; background-color: #D8D8D8;}

.req			{color: rgb(128,0,0); font-family; Arial, Verdana, Helvetica; font-size: 8pt; font-weight: normal; 
vertical-align: text-top}

.hand	{cursor: pointer; cursor: hand}
.ul 		{width: 8px; height: 8px; margin: 2px 3px 1px 5px}


select			{ font-family: Tahoma, Arial, Helvetica; font-size: 12px}
img.arm		{margin-right: 5px; width: 4px; height: 7px;}


.lh	th		{ padding: 2px; border-collapse: collapse; border: 1px solid #B3D9FF; background: #FE9202; font-weight: bold; font-size: 10px; font-family: Tahoma, Verdana; text-align: center; }
.lh     tbody.info	td    { font-size: 12px; padding-left: 5px; text-align: left; }
.lh	tbody.info	td.desc { font-size: 11px; }
.lh	td.name		{ text-align: left; padding-left: 5px }
.lh	td		{ padding: 2px; border-collapse: collapse; border: 1px solid #83D9FF; background: #FE9202; font-size: 11px; text-align: center }
.lh	a:link		{ color: #000000; border: 0px none }
.lh	a:visited 	{ color: #000000; border: 0px none }
.lh	a:active	{ color: #000000; border: 0px none }
.lh	a:hover		{ color: #FFFFFF; border: 0px none }

.bltd1  		{ background: url('/img/bb-1.jpg') repeat-y; background-position: left center; height: 210px }
.bltd2  		{ background: url('/img/bb-2.jpg') repeat-y; background-position: left center; height: 210px }
.bltd3 			{ background: url('/img/bb-3.jpg') repeat-y; background-position: left center; height: 210px }

.bl-b			{ width: 160px; }
.bl-b	td		{ height: 17px; border-bottom: 1px solid #96A9C6; text-align: left; vertical-align: middle; font-size: 11px; font-family: tahoma; }
.bl-b	td.last		{ border-bottom: 0px none }
.bl			{ }

.blt1		{ background: url('/img/bt-1.jpg') no-repeat; background-position: left top; height: 100%; width: 236px; }
.blt2		{ background: url('/img/bt-2.jpg') no-repeat; background-position: left top; height: 100%; width: 236px; }
.blt3		{ background: url('/img/bt-3.jpg') no-repeat; background-position: left top; height: 100%; width: 236px; }

.bl	td.t1		{ background: url('/img/ba-1.jpg') no-repeat;  background-position: 0px 0px; height: 100%; width: 236px;}
.bl	td.t2		{ background: url('/img/ba-2.jpg') no-repeat;}
.bl	td.t3		{ background: url('/img/ba-3.jpg') no-repeat;}
.bl     td.t            { background-position: left bottom; height: 100%; vertical-align: top }


.bl	td.t table 	{ width: 100%; }
.bl	div.h		{ padding-left: 14px; padding-top: 0px; }
.bl 	div.p		{ font-family: Tahoma; font-weight: bold; font-size: 14pt; color: yellow; text-align: left;}
.bl	div.p span 	{ font-size: 10px;}
.bl	td.m		{ height: 100%; vertical-align: top; }
.bl	td.m table	{ width: 167px }

.bl	td.h		{ padding: 8px 0px 16px 16px; }
.bl	td.h		a { font-family: Helvetica; font-weight: bold; font-size: 14pt; color: #FCE55D;}
.bl	td.h		span { font-weight: bold; font-size: 9px; color: #FFFFFF;}
.bl	td.h		img { float: right; margin: 10px 35px 0px 0px}

.nd	a:link          { color: #FFFFFF; border: 0px none }
.nd	a:visited       { color: #FFFFFF; border: 0px none }
.nd	a:active        { color: #FFFFFF; border: 0px none }
.nd	a:hover         { color: #FFFFFF; border: 0px none }

.i185x53 { width: 185px; height: 53px; border: 0px }
.ial { float: left; padding-right: 5px }

.center	{ text-align: center }
.bold 	{ font-weight: bold }
.red  	{ color: red }
.green 	{ color: green }

.txt-sub { font-size: 10px }
.txt-main { font-size: 11px; font-family: Tahoma; color: #FFFFFF}
.txt-main-hdr { font-size: 16px; font-family: Arial; font-weight: bold; color: #FFFFFF;}
h1 { font-size: 16px; font-family: Arial; font-weight: bold; color: #FFFFFF;}

.style1 {
	color: #ffffff;
	font-size: 11px;
	font-family: tahoma;
	line-height:14px
}
.style2 {
	color: #ffffff;
	font-size: 11px;
	font-family: tahoma;
}
.style3 {
	color: #DD9D4E;
	font-size: 11px;
	font-family: tahoma;
}
.style4 {
	color: #d3dce9;
	font-size: 11px;
	font-family: tahoma;
}
.style5 {
	color: #FE9D4E;
	font-size: 11px;
	font-family: tahoma;
}
.style6 {
	color: #f0d7b4;
	font-size: 11px;
	font-family: tahoma;
	line-height:15px
}
.style7 {
	color: #f2c5b4;
	font-size: 10px;
	font-family: tahoma;
	line-height:14px
}
.style8 {
	color: #DE774E;
	font-size: 10px;
	font-family: tahoma;
}

